Ticket: Staging env misconfigured for Siftgate bloom filter

The bloom layer in front of the Pellet KV store is rejecting all lookups in staging because the env file was copied from the dev template without credentials. False-positive tuning values are fine; only the auth line is missing. To unblock the weekly demo, the Pellet admission secret must be set on the following line.

env line for yaguf-fajop: LEDGER_TOKEN13=fb08984397349

Subject: Cut-over summary — Quibbler planner rollback

Team, the cut-over from planner v4 back to v3 on the Ostermere cluster finished cleanly last night. The v4 regression (nested-join cost misestimates) is gone and p95 latency is back under target. No data movement was required, only a restart wave. Please review before we re-enable v4 behind a flag. The cluster is now running with the following configuration.

config for tajof-tajef:
ralael:
  pin: 3468
  metrics_host: metrics.ralael.lumicsys.internal
  tenant: casath
  seal: seal_c325d9c6

Subject: Verdane Grill franchise agreement — heads up

Hi all,

Quick one before Thursday. The franchise agreement with the Verdane Grill group in Port Alder is basically done — legal signed off yesterday, and the royalty structure landed where finance wanted it (6% flat, quarterly remittance). Marta's team will fold the projections into next month's pack. One wrinkle: they want exclusivity across the whole Calloway region, which changes our own expansion math. Before we counter, please read the confidential note below on where we're headed.

confidential, bahap-bajog: Zorethix Works is in early talks to buy Kelethox Foods for about $30.7 million. The Ralvan launch date is September 19, and nothing goes to the press before then.